I work with Peter Yoon and am attempting to implement a DALI to Tcoffee workflow.

Tcoffee runs perfectly locally, but upon processing the same files through our server, Tcoffee seems to produce nonASCII characters in the first merge step causing a fatal error when merging the final msa. Our files and scripts are all UTF-8 encoded and the error only appears upon the first Tcoffee call in a singularity container.

A workaround to this is to isolate each merge step and iterate the merging however this scales the processing time by 100x. The characters are printable in ISO-8859-1 Latin 1 encryption. Using a previous version and simply implementing sanitization functions do not fix this issue.

I was wondering if we are surpassing Tcoffee's processing limit like the MAXNPID error of previous models or if there were any encryption logic errors.

I do not think it has to do with the max-PID. If you could send one of the faulty output I will investigate 

Not much thought got into the encoding. I am just using the standard ascii, there is also not too much checking going on on the input side and it could be that some char slipping through may cause damages at some point.
